English: Harlem Globetrotters guard Saul ‘Flip’ White, left, displays his ball handling wizardry to the crowd Dec. 9 at The Foster Field House on Camp Foster. The Harlem Globetrotters displayed their basketball artistry to service members and their families in a showdown with their rivals, the Washington Generals. The event was a part of the Harlem Globetrotters 13th military tour, in which the team travels overseas to U.S. military installations to provide memories of home during the holidays. The game was presented by Navy Entertainment, Leatherneck Tour and Marine Corps Community Services. (Marine Corps Photo by Cpl. Joey S. Holeman, Jr./ Released) |
